For decades, trans characters were either depicted as deceptive villains or tragic punchlines. The turning point came with actors like Laverne Cox, whose groundbreaking role in Orange Is the New Black landed her on the cover of Time magazine in 2014, signaling a "transgender tipping point." Shows like Pose made history by casting the largest number of transgender actors in series regular roles, bringing authentic ballroom history to mainstream television.
